Etu Finau, born on March 15, 2002, in Salt Lake City, Utah, has made a name for himself in the world of college football. Standing at 6'4" and weighing 250 pounds, Finau's physical presence is as imposing as his athletic ability. He began his football journey in high school, where his talent quickly became evident, earning him a spot in the NCAAF.
Finau's playing style is characterized by his exceptional speed and agility for a player of his size. Known for his versatility, he excels in both offensive and defensive roles. His ability to read the game and make quick decisions on the field sets him apart, making him a key asset to his team.
Throughout his NCAAF career, Finau has achieved several milestones, including being named to the All-Conference team in his sophomore year. His consistent performance has not only contributed to his team's success but has also caught the attention of professional scouts, setting the stage for a promising future in football.
